Gov. Brad Little is the 33rd Governor of Idaho, and has been working on several key issues over the last year: wildfire management, water calls, preserving women’s sports, federal government overreach, and more. He also announced today for the first time that Idaho has finally reached a water usage agreement between ranches, farmers, and all water users.
